John Badenhorst (19**-) Actor, Dancer, Director


Biography

Born circa 1950.


Training

He trained at Rhodes University and at the Accademia Nazzionale D’Arte Drammatica in Rome.


Career

M-Net film and literary awards judge or administrator

Contribution to SA theatre, film, media and/or performance

As a student he had a role in Putsonderwater (1969). He had a role in Othello Slegs Blankes (1972). Other productions include The Caucasian Chalk Circle, Romeo and Juliet, Antigone, Oklahoma!, Camelot, The Milk Train Doesn't Stop Here Anymore (pre-1982), Hamlet, Godspell, Twelfth Night.

Produced and directed Salomé (1981), Edward II (1981), Bent (1981).

He directed the film Slavery of Love in 1999.
